Unraveling the Breadth of Soil Chemistry
"The Chemistry of Soils" offers an unparalleled overview of the subject, covering a vast array of topics essential for a thorough understanding of soil chemistry. From soil minerals and organic matter to soil acidity and ion exchange processes, the book delves into the fundamental principles that govern the behavior of soils.
1. Soil Minerals: The Building Blocks of Soil
Sposito meticulously describes the different types of soil minerals, their composition, and their impact on soil properties. The book provides insights into the formation, weathering, and transformation of minerals, shedding light on their role in nutrient availability and soil fertility.
2. Organic Matter: The Life Force of Soil
The book comprehensively addresses the composition and properties of soil organic matter, emphasizing its crucial role in maintaining soil health and fertility. Sposito explores the interactions between organic matter and soil minerals, providing a deeper understanding of organic matter decomposition and nutrient cycling.
3. Soil Acidity: Understanding the pH Balance
Soil pH is a critical factor that influences the availability of nutrients and microbial activity. "The Chemistry of Soils" thoroughly explains the factors that control soil acidity, including the chemistry of acids and bases and the role of soil buffers. This knowledge empowers readers to make informed decisions regarding soil amendments and management practices.
4. Ion Exchange Processes: Governing Nutrient Availability
The book delves into the complex world of ion exchange processes, describing how they influence the retention and release of plant nutrients in soils. Sposito provides a clear explanation of the different types of ion exchange reactions and their practical implications for soil fertility and environmental management.
